RD130 Rural Community Economic Development
This course provides a comprehensive introduction to rural community economic development (CED), focusing on the unique challenges and opportunities faced by rural areas. You will learn foundational concepts such as the multiplier effect, capital leakage, and industry distinctions, and explore best practices through case studies and real-world examples. The course covers strategies for capital access, broadband expansion, leadership development, and targeted economic initiatives like loan programs and business incubators. Special attention is given to approaches for under-resourced and marginalized communities. Equip yourself to make informed, strategic decisions that foster sustainable rural economic growth.
